Herts County Council has maintained its standing as one of the nation’s leading gay-friendly employers in the latest Stonewall Workplace Equality Index.
The council is one of only 18 local authorities to make the list, and has improved its ranking to 53 in the annual Top 100 index.
Councillor Derrick Ashley, cabinet member for equality and diversity, said: “Our improved position in the index acknowledges the hard work the county council puts into its equality policies.”
Employers who made the list were assessed on their employee policies, staff engagement, learning and development support and external and community engagement.
